Choosing Your Perfect Traditional Greek Cooking Class
Finding the ideal traditional Greek cooking class in Thessaloniki means considering a few factors to match your preferences. Look for classes that offer a hands-on approach, where you actively participate in the cooking process, rather than just observing. Many popular options include a visit to a local market to select fresh produce, which is a fantastic bonus. Small group sizes often provide a more personalized and intimate learning environment. Don’t hesitate to read reviews to gauge the instructor’s expertise and the overall atmosphere. Beyond the Kitchen: Exploring Thessaloniki’s Food Scene
After perfecting your dishes in traditional Greek cooking classes, your culinary journey in Thessaloniki is far from over. The skills you gain will enhance your appreciation for the city’s vibrant food scene. Take your newfound knowledge and explore local markets like Modiano or Kapani with a fresh perspective, identifying fresh ingredients and local specialties. My personal take: post-class, a stroll through the bustling market brings all the flavors to life and connects the dots! Indulge in authentic tavernas, visit specialty delis, or even find local bakeries for traditional sweets.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Are traditional Greek cooking classes in Thessaloniki suitable for beginners?
A: Absolutely! Most traditional Greek cooking classes in Thessaloniki are designed to accommodate all skill levels, from complete novices to seasoned home cooks. Instructors typically guide participants step-by-step through recipes, ensuring everyone feels comfortable and confident.
Q: What kind of dishes can I expect to learn in a Thessaloniki cooking class?
A: You can expect to learn a variety of classic Greek dishes, often including appetizers like tzatziki, main courses such as moussaka or pastitsio, and possibly a traditional dessert or salad. Classes frequently highlight regional specialties unique to Northern Greece and Thessaloniki.
Q: How long do traditional Greek cooking classes typically last?
A: The duration of traditional Greek cooking classes in Thessaloniki usually ranges from 3 to 5 hours. This often includes time for preparation, hands-on cooking, and then enjoying the meal you’ve collectively prepared, sometimes with a local wine pairing.
